Sysco Virginia has made a major gift to the Blue Ridge Area Food Bank, committing at least $38,000 over two years to support food bank operations as part of their Nourishing Neighbors program.
Each year, the Food Bank provides more than 21 million meals to hungry children, seniors, and families through a network of partner food pantries, soup kitchens, and shelters, as well as several nutrition programs.

America Recycles Day, a Keep America Beautiful national initiative that takes place on and in the weeks leading into Nov. 15, recognizes the economic, environmental and social benefits of recycling, and provides an educational platform to raise awareness about the value of reducing, reusing and recycling – every day – throughout the year.
